Sunset Spots in Pula: Where to Watch the Sunset Over the Adriatic



Pula, a charming coastal city in Croatia, is renowned for its ancient Roman ruins, stunning beaches, and picturesque harbor. However, it’s the breathtaking sunsets that truly make this city unforgettable. If you’re visiting Pula, don’t miss the chance to experience the vibrant colors of the sky as the sun dips below the horizon. Here are some of the best spots in Pula to enjoy a magical sunset

Pula Arena



If you want to blend history with a mesmerizing sunset, the Pula Arena is the place to be. As one of the world’s best-preserved Roman amphitheaters, this ancient marvel transforms into a breathtaking spectacle as the sun begins its descent. The golden light spills through its mighty stone arches, casting long shadows and illuminating centuries of history. Imagine standing where gladiators once fought, now surrounded by a serene atmosphere as the sky turns shades of crimson and gold. Watching the sun dip behind these legendary walls is more than just a sunset—it’s a journey through time, where past and present merge in a moment of pure magic.



Kamenjak National Park



For nature lovers, Kamenjak National Park is an unmissable paradise where wild beauty meets breathtaking sunsets. Just a short drive from Pula, this protected gem boasts dramatic cliffs, hidden coves, and crystal-clear waters that seem to stretch endlessly toward the horizon. As the sun begins to set, golden rays dance on the waves, painting the rugged coastline in warm, fiery hues. The scent of pine lingers in the air, and the rhythmic sounds of the sea create a peaceful symphony. Whether you find a quiet spot on the cliffs or relax on a secluded beach, watching the sunset here feels like stepping into a postcard-perfect dream.


Fort Bourguignon



Perched on a hill just outside Pula, Fort Bourguignon is a hidden treasure where history and nature collide in a stunning sunset spectacle. This Austro-Hungarian relic, once a silent guardian of the coast, now offers a peaceful retreat with sweeping views of the city and the endless Adriatic Sea. As the sun begins its descent, golden light spills over the fortress walls, casting a warm glow on the weathered stone. The air is still, the atmosphere serene—making it the perfect spot for a romantic escape or a quiet moment of reflection. Away from the crowds, this overlooked gem invites you to step back in time while witnessing one of Pula’s most enchanting sunsets.
